Which is a better buy: universal life (UL) or participating whole life (WL) insurance?

0

There’s no simple answer to this. The best performing product (from a financial perspective), whether UL, WL or some other type of cash value life insurance, will likely be the one that reveals the most favorable interest earnings, actual expenses and mortality costs. Insurers earning the highest investment income, and who also incur the lowest expenses and the lowest mortality costs, are in the best position to offer life insurance at the lowest cost. This is true whether the cash value product being offered is UL or WL. You and your adviser should carefully examine the financial aspects of each product under consideration.
